Thursday, August 28, 2008 CHICAGO -- Defenders Danny Califf, Michael Orozco and Marvell Wynne were added to the U.S. roster for next month's World Cup qualifiers against Cuba, and Trinidad and Tobago. Midfielder Ricardo Clark also was among 20 players selected Thursday by U.S. coach Bob Bradley. Injured midfielder Pablo Mastroeni was dropped along with defender Jay DeMerit.
